The Hupp Tracheal Retractor is a specialized surgical instrument used primarily in procedures involving the trachea, such as tracheostomies and other airway surgeries. It is 6 inches (approximately 15 cm) in length and double-ended, offering two retraction options in one tool.
One end features three prongs, typically blunt or semi-sharp, ideal for retracting tracheal rings or cartilage without causing excessive trauma. The opposite end is a single hook, designed for delicate tissue manipulation or retraction around the trachea and larynx. This dual functionality minimizes the need to switch instruments during surgery.
Made from high-quality surgical stainless steel, the retractor is corrosion-resistant, durable, and fully autoclavable. Its straight shaft and compact size make it easy to control and suitable for use in confined surgical fields, especially in pediatric or delicate procedures.
